Nominations Triple for Franklin & Marshall STEM Posse

Winter 2013 | Miami

The Miami community is poised to contribute a second STEM Posse to Franklin & Marshall College. This year Posse Miami received over 170 STEM (Science, Technology, Engineering and Math) nominations from local public high schools and community-based organizations, more than tripling the previous year’s count.

The talent of these nominated students was evident throughout the Dynamic Assessment Process (DAP), Posse’s unique method for assessing student potential. Their creativity and leadership are sure indications that Miami’s STEM Posse will continue to break boundaries and excel.

In addition, Posse Miami received 1,100 nominations for its traditional Posse programs at Hamilton College, Mount Holyoke College and Syracuse University.
